Naming

Choosing a name you won't regret.

You will read this name down a phone line, put it on a vehicle and type it a thousand times. A few minutes here is worth more than any of the extensions you might buy.

Worth doing before you buy

  • Say it out loud to somebody and have them spell it back. If they get it wrong, the name is wrong.
  • Shorter beats clever. Every extra word is another chance to mistype it.
  • Avoid hyphens and numbers — nobody says "dash" out loud, and "4" or "four" doubles the guesses.
  • Skip anything tied to one product or one town unless you're certain you'll never outgrow it.
  • Search the name at CIPC and as a trademark first. A domain won't protect you from somebody who owns the name.
  • If an obvious misspelling exists, take that too and redirect it. It's a year's registration against a lifetime of lost visitors.

How quickly is it live?

A .co.za is usually active within the hour, and .com, .net and .org are close to immediate. Allow up to a working day for the change to be visible everywhere, because networks around the world cache the answer for a while.

Should I register more than one extension?

If the .com of your name is free and you're a South African business trading locally, take both it and the .co.za. Point one at the other and use the one you want people to type. It's a small yearly cost against a competitor buying the other half of your name later.

Can I register a name for a business I haven't started yet?

Yes. Register it in your own name now and we'll move it to the company once it's registered. Holding the name early costs a year's fee; discovering it's gone the week you launch costs a rebrand.
